import DIVEToolbox, { type ToolType } from '../Toolbox';
import type DIVEOrbitControls from '../../controls/OrbitControls';
import { type DIVEScene } from '../../scene/Scene';
/**
* @jest-environment jsdom
*/
jest.mock('../select/SelectTool.ts', () => {
return {
DIVESelectTool: jest.fn(function () {
this.Activate = jest.fn();
this.Deactivate = jest.fn();
this.onPointerDown = jest.fn();
this.onPointerMove = jest.fn();
this.onPointerUp = jest.fn();
this.onWheel = jest.fn();
this.SetGizmoMode = jest.fn();
this.SetGizmoVisibility = jest.fn();
this.SetGizmoScaleLinked = jest.fn();
return this;
}),
};
});
const mockController = {
domElement: {
width: 0,
height: 0,
addEventListener: jest.fn((type, callback) => {
callback();
}),
getContext: jest.fn(),
removeEventListener: jest.fn((type, callback) => {
callback();
}),
clientWidth: 0,
clientHeight: 0,
offsetLeft: 0,
offsetTop: 0,
},
object: {},
} as unknown as DIVEOrbitControls;
describe('dive/toolbox/DIVEToolBox', () => {
afterEach(() => {
jest.clearAllMocks();
});
it('should instantiate', () => {
const toolBox = new DIVEToolbox({} as DIVEScene, mockController);
expect(toolBox).toBeDefined();
});
it('should dispose', () => {
const toolBox = new DIVEToolbox({} as DIVEScene, mockController);
toolBox.Dispose();
});
it('should throw with incorrect tool', () => {
const spy = jest.spyOn(console, 'warn').mockImplementation();
const toolBox = new DIVEToolbox({} as DIVEScene, mockController);
expect(() =>
toolBox.UseTool('not a real tool' as unknown as ToolType),
).not.toThrow();
expect(spy).toHaveBeenCalled();
});
it('should use no tool', () => {
const toolBox = new DIVEToolbox({} as DIVEScene, mockController);
expect(() => toolBox.UseTool('select')).not.toThrow();
expect(() => toolBox.UseTool('none')).not.toThrow();
});
it('should use select tool', () => {
const toolBox = new DIVEToolbox({} as DIVEScene, mockController);
expect(() => toolBox.UseTool(DIVEToolbox.DefaultTool)).not.toThrow();
});
it('should execute pointer down event on tool', () => {
const toolBox = new DIVEToolbox({} as DIVEScene, mockController);
expect(() =>
toolBox.onPointerDown({ type: 'pointerdown' } as PointerEvent),
).not.toThrow();
expect(() => toolBox.UseTool('select')).not.toThrow();
expect(() =>
toolBox.onPointerDown({ type: 'pointerdown' } as PointerEvent),
).not.toThrow();
});
it('should execute pointer move event on tool', () => {
const toolBox = new DIVEToolbox({} as DIVEScene, mockController);
expect(() =>
toolBox.onPointerMove({ type: 'pointermove' } as PointerEvent),
).not.toThrow();
expect(() => toolBox.UseTool('select')).not.toThrow();
expect(() =>
toolBox.onPointerMove({ type: 'pointermove' } as PointerEvent),
).not.toThrow();
});
it('should execute pointer up event on tool', () => {
const toolBox = new DIVEToolbox({} as DIVEScene, mockController);
expect(() =>
toolBox.onPointerUp({ type: 'pointerup' } as PointerEvent),
).not.toThrow();
expect(() => toolBox.UseTool('select')).not.toThrow();
expect(() =>
toolBox.onPointerUp({ type: 'pointerup' } as PointerEvent),
).not.toThrow();
});
it('should execute wheel event on tool', () => {
const toolBox = new DIVEToolbox({} as DIVEScene, mockController);
expect(() =>
toolBox.onWheel({ type: 'wheel' } as WheelEvent),
).not.toThrow();
expect(() => toolBox.UseTool('select')).not.toThrow();
expect(() =>
toolBox.onWheel({ type: 'wheel' } as WheelEvent),
).not.toThrow();
});
it('should get active tool', () => {
const toolBox = new DIVEToolbox({} as DIVEScene, mockController);
expect(toolBox.GetActiveTool()).toBeDefined();
});
it('should set gizmo mode', () => {
const toolBox = new DIVEToolbox({} as DIVEScene, mockController);
expect(() => toolBox.SetGizmoMode('translate')).not.toThrow();
});
it('should set gizmo active', () => {
const toolBox = new DIVEToolbox({} as DIVEScene, mockController);
expect(() => toolBox.SetGizmoVisibility(true)).not.toThrow();
});
it('should set gizmo unified scale', () => {
const toolBox = new DIVEToolbox({} as DIVEScene, mockController);
expect(() => toolBox.SetGizmoScaleLinked(true)).not.toThrow();
});
});
